EMEA(东亚环境监测)项目旨在促进植被研究方面的合作,特别侧重于遥感及其地面实况,由中国、韩国和日本的贡献组成。它始于2002年,我们进行了实地工作,会议和研讨会。1.利用卫星数据分析植被环境现象往往表现出不同的特点,这取决于观测的规模。为了检测环境变化,确定空间和时间分辨率是重要的。为了监测植被特征,利用NOAA、Landsat、IKONOS等多种卫星遥感资料进行了研究,利用NOAA数据分析了植被的时间变化,利用Landsat数据分析了植被的时空变化。为了利用IKONOS卫星1 m空间分辨率的数据进行单木检测和树种分类,采用了一些图像处理技术。2.中国和韩国的实地研究我们于2002年8月访问了韩国北方地区,2002年9月访问了中国北方地区,2004年9月和2005年8月在中国东北地区举办了国际会议和研讨会。(东亚生态学会联合会)国际大会,2004年10月20日至24日,韩国木浦。利用遥感监测植被变化(2)IEEE国际地球科学和遥感专题讨论会,韩国首尔,2005年7月25日至29日,会议名称:利用卫星图像分析东亚植被。(3)EMEA(东亚环境监测)国际专题讨论会,金泽,日本,2005年11月28日至29日。

The EMEA (Environmental Monitoring in East Asia) project has been designed to promote cooperation in vegetation research with a particular focus on the remote sensing and its ground truth, and consisted of contributions from China, Korea and Japan. It started in 2002, and we had field works, meetings and symposium.1.Analysis of vegetation using satellite dataEnvironmental phenomena often exhibit different characteristics depending on the scale of the observations. To detect environmental changes, determination of spatial and temporal resolution is important. To monitor vegetation characteristics, we conducted research by using of a several kinds satellite remote sensing such as NOAA, Landsat or IKONOS.Temporal change of vegetation was analyzed using NOAA data and spatio-temporal change of vegetation was analyzed using Landsat data. In order to detect individual trees and classify tree species using IKONOS data with 1 m spatial resolution, some image processing techniques were adapted.2.Field research in China and KoreaWe visited northern parts of South Korea in August 2002, northern China in September 2002, and northeastern China in September 2004 and August 2005.3.Organization of international conferences and symposium(1)EAFES (East Asian Federation of Ecological Societies) International Congress, Mokpo, Korea, 20-24 October 2004.Session title : Utilization of remote sensing for monitoring of vegetation change(2)IEEE International Geoscience and Remote Sensing Symposium, Seoul, Korea, 25-29 July 2005.Session title : Utilization of satellite imagery for analysis of vegetation in East Asia.(3)EMEA (Environmental Monitoring in East Asia) International Symposium, Kanazawa, Japan, 28-29 November 2005.Theme : Remote sensing and forests
